Job summary

Fairmont Hotels & Resorts, located in New Orleans, seeks a Front Office Manager to lead guest services for a luxury property. The role requires supervision of reception teams, ongoing staff training, and collaboration with other departments to ensure top-tier guest experiences.

Reporting to the Front Office Manager, you will oversee recruitment, training, scheduling, and performance management while maintaining service standards and regulatory compliance.

Qualifications

  • Minimum 2 years experience in a Hotel leadership role.
  • Computer literacy with property management systems (e.g., PROPERTYmanager), Excel, Word.
  • Strong interpersonal and communication skills.
  • Experience in interviewing and staff development.

Responsibilities

  • Consistently offer professional, friendly and engaging service
  • Ensure guest satisfaction levels and standards of quality of service in addition to actively developing and implementing new systems and standards
  • Handle of guests comments and complaints, ensuring guests needs are met or exceeded,
  • Participate in interviewing and recruitment of Front Office Reception Agents
  • Ensure efficient training and development of personnel by means of detailed systems and procedures in the Front Office (training manuals, fact sheets, internal coding systems, etc.)
  • Oversee and participate in guest relations and directs arrangements for VIP and special attention reservations
  • Give effective support to staff for the work, which has to be done and assists in all matters pertaining to the Front Office
  • Organize, coordinate and supervise training, conduct regular training sessions and communications meetings
  • Responsible for development and performance management of all Front Office colleagues
  • Coordinate and communicate of information pertinent to all other departments to ensure the highest level of guest service
  • Knowledge in emergency procedures, general crisis situation procedures and keeping health and safety in the forefront
  • Ensure that all controls are in place and are adhered to, ie. rates, market codes, etc.
  • Reviewing and revising daily reports and ensuring they are in line with SAQ standards
  • Responsible for coordinate with the Reservation Manager and the Guest Services Managers all preparations for incoming conventions, groups and tours as well as all pre-arrival including blocking of rooms, convention resumes, special requirements and departure activities
  • Maintain and assist the Front Office Manager on ongoing training and motivation programs
  • Responsible for all details of employees administration, payroll forecasts, payroll administration on a daily, weekly and monthly basis
  • Maintain and submit to the Front Office Manager, approved staffing schedules on a weekly basis
  • Must maintain a flexible schedule and be available to work overnight shifts when operational needs require, including occasional coverage of overnight operations.
  • Responsible for personal cash float
  • Ensure Fairmont policies and procedures are known, followed and enforced, promote the philosophy of empowerment within guidelines
  • In all that we do create and be responsible for smart goals that help to achieve EOS, VOG, RevPAR, GOP yearly objectives
  • All other duties assigned
